Analysis
St. Pierre and Miquelon recorded 1.6% for annual percentage change in primary energy use in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 92.0% on the previous year and down 69.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, annual percentage change in primary energy use in St. Pierre and Miquelon peaked at 33.3% in 1998 and was at its lowest, -43.0%, in 1993.
That places St. Pierre and Miquelon 108th out of 213 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 7.1% | -10.2% | 28.6% | 9 |
| 1990s | -10.6% | -43.0% | 33.3% | 10 |
| 2000s | 3.8% | -3.7% | 12.9% | 10 |
| 2010s | -1.0% | -28.3% | 6.9% | 10 |
| 2020s | 0.3% | -10.6% | 19.8% | 5 |
